Banking and Financial Control Improvements
Financial systems are now directly connected to banking tools.
Businesses now rely on:
- small business bank account integrations
- best checking account small business connections
- automated transaction tracking
- real-time reconciliation
This removes the need to manually match bank statements with books.
It also reduces delays and improves accuracy significantly.
Why Online Bookkeeping Services Improve Decision Making
The biggest shift is not just automation. It is visibility.
With online bookkeeping services, business owners can see financial performance instantly.
This includes:
- cash flow tracking in real time
- profit and loss visibility
- expense monitoring
- revenue trends analysis
- budgeting based on live data
So decisions are no longer based on guesses or outdated reports.
They are based on actual numbers happening right now.
